Our History
Greg
and Carol Griffin began ElderSpan Management, LLC in 1995. Greg has a 40-year
history in the healthcare industry as a strategic planner, a hospital administrator
and as a consultant to hospitals in crisis. Carol is a Registered Nurse
with an unfailing love for the elderly. When Carol's mother started to need
more assistance, Greg and Carol found there was a need for more choices
in senior living and decided to enter the industry.
In July of 1995, they opened their first assisted living residence, The Pines Assisted Living in Prairie du Sac, WI. Unfortunately, Carol’s mother passed away just weeks before, so she never got to live in the facility that had been built with her in mind. However, others were immediately attracted to the design and atmosphere of The Pines, and its success resulted in a decision to develop other residences. The company has now grown to numerous assisted living buildings, memory care buildings and senior apartments.
ElderSpan began as a family business and it remains a family business. Greg and Carol are the majority stakeholders of the corporation; their son, David, is the chief operating officer; and their son-in-law Jon oversees development, construction and maintenance. Even though the corporation now serves over 170 residents and employs over 150 staff members, every person is still considered an important part of the ElderSpan family.
